This alert fires when the Stormfeather fan-out lags more than ninety seconds behind the upstream weather feed. Usually it's one stuck shard in the Galepipe relay rather than the whole pipeline, so don't panic — check shard lag first and restart only the laggard. If the whole fleet is behind, that's a feed issue, not ours. Triage steps and the restart procedure are written up on the internal fan-out page.

operations page: https://confluence.nelvroworks.example/dash/spaces/board/job/pipeline/issue/spaces/b9c0f0fbc164027c4eb481af

Plugin authors have reported that unit-conversion behavior differs between the sandbox and production, producing inconsistent yields for batch scaling. Investigation shows the production node was hand-edited during the Marlowe incident and never reconciled with the declared baseline. Until the reconciliation job lands, plugin authors should treat the sandbox as non-authoritative and validate against the values documented here. For reference, the production configuration as currently deployed is as follows.

settings of fajop-fahap:
[holeth]
port = 9300
team = juleth
host = holeth.tolvaqsoft.example
region = south-4
access_code = ac_4bcdf6
timeout_ms = 500

Q3 Planning Note — Finance Team

Effective immediately: hiring freeze in the Coastline Logistics division. All open requisitions paused; backfills require CFO sign-off. Contractor renewals capped at 90 days. Payroll forecast to be restated by end of week. Savings target: 4% of divisional opex this quarter. No exceptions for the Marwick depot expansion until further notice. The reasoning behind the freeze is covered in the note below, which does not leave this team.

management briefing: Headcount on the Quenael team goes from 9 to 80 by the end of July. Gross margin on Quenael came in at 15 percent against a plan of 20 percent.